kasan: ensure poisoning size alignment
A previous changes d99f6a10c161 ("kasan: don't round_up too much") attempted to simplify the code by adding a round_up(size) call into kasan_poison(). While this allows to have less round_up() calls around the code, this results in round_up() being called multiple times. This patch removes round_up() of size from kasan_poison() and ensures that all callers round_up() the size explicitly. This patch also adds WARN_ON() alignment checks for address and size to kasan_poison() and kasan_unpoison().
